Output 51bc03cdc94adab3fd8b497ebc303daff4bb146a71b8e44c071fe7ecd8534b95:1

value
25354903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b670a5b5abdca839cb3340546e7de1395c0f254 OP_EQUAL
address
MBrej4AMrbNByHWgpaoPDQEfk969HkTHey
transaction
51bc03cdc94adab3fd8b497ebc303daff4bb146a71b8e44c071fe7ecd8534b95
spent
true